From the Paper
"Not long after penicillin was introduced for the treatment of a variety of infections, the first strains of penicillin-resistant bacteria began to appear. The nature of the bacterial lifecycle made them more capable of rapid evolution to respond to antibiotics. Bacteria reproduce so quickly (usually on the order of a few hours) that any mutations introduced are rapidly propagated through the generations. When a chance mutation enables a bacterium to resist antibiotics, this bacterium survives and quickly replicates, passing this resistant mutation on to subsequent generations. The problem is made more severe when doctors prescribe antibiotics more as a treatment of psychological complaints than genuine bacterial infections. To further complicate the issue of antibiotic resistance, patients sometimes do not finish a course of antibiotics. Assuming they're well and the infection has been cured, patients may stop a course of treatment prematurely. This results in the less hardy bacteria being killed off, while the more resistant bacteria remain to reinfect, and reinfect more virulently."

From the Paper
"The scientific name of anthrax, bacillus anthracis, is derived from anthrakis, the Greek word for coal. The reason for this is that the disease caused by the substance is associated with black, lesions that look like coal in some cases. The cellular appearance of anthrax can be identified with fair certainty by experienced microbiologists. The problem is however that few of these professionals not working in the veterinary community have had the opportunity to either work with or see the cellular or colonial appearance of anthrax. This makes it difficult to identify and prevent the effects of the weapon in practice."

From the Paper
"Sickle cell anemia is an inherited blood disorder in which hemoglobin is defective (Genetic disease profile: Sickle cell anemia). After hemoglobin molecules give up their oxygen, some cluster together and form long, rod-like structures. These structures cause red blood cells to become stiff and assume a sickle shape that makes it difficult for them to squeeze through small blood vessels. As a result, they stack up and cause blockages that deprive organs and tissues of oxygen-carrying blood. Sickle cell anemia affects millions world wide (Genetic disease profile: Sickle cell anemia). It is the most common among people whose ancestors come from sub-Saharan Africa; Spanish-speaking regions (South America, Cuba, Central America); Saudi Arabia; India; and Mediterranean countries such as Turkey, Greece, and Italy."
